HG07 YTD is a 2007 Volkswagen Polo in Black with a 1,800c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.6%.
Across all 2007 Volkswagen Polo models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.9% with a typical mileage of 62,240 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Polo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 467,706 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HG07 YTD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Polo typ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 19 years old, this Volkswagen Polo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
